If people can comment on this ticket whether the following is true in
their case, then the following page can be updated.
"In your firmware, disable QuickBoot/FastBoot and Intel Smart Response
Technology (SRT). If you have Windows 8, also disable Fast Startup...
Support for UEFI SecureBoot appeared in 12.10 and 12.04.2."
https://help.ubuntu.com/community/UEFI#General_principles
In my case I disabled both FastBoot and SecureBoot so maybe FastBoot was
the root cause.
